Message type: E = Error
Message class: CNV_12000 - Messages for shorttext and description conversion
Message number: 054
Message text: Description for the same target object has also been updated

- Description for the same target object has also been updated ?The SAP error message CNV_12000054 typically occurs during data migration or conversion processes, particularly when using the SAP S/4HANA Migration Cockpit or other data migration tools. This error indicates that there is a conflict in the data being processed, specifically that the description for the same target object has been updated multiple times.
Cause:
The error can arise due to several reasons:
- Duplicate Entries: The same target object is being updated with different descriptions in the migration data, leading to a conflict.
- Data Consistency Issues: There may be inconsistencies in the source data that are being migrated, causing multiple updates to the same target object.
- Incorrect Mapping: The mapping of source fields to target fields may not be correctly defined, leading to multiple updates for the same target object.
Solution:
To resolve this error, you can take the following steps:
Review the Migration Data:
- Check the source data for duplicate entries related to the target object. Ensure that each target object has a unique description.
Check Mapping Configuration:
- Verify the mapping configuration in the migration tool. Ensure that the source fields are correctly mapped to the target fields and that there are no overlaps that could cause multiple updates.
Data Cleansing:
- Cleanse the source data to remove any duplicates or inconsistencies before running the migration again.
Use a Unique Identifier:
- If applicable, ensure that each entry has a unique identifier that can help differentiate between records during the migration process.
Consult Logs:
- Review the migration logs for more detailed information about the error. This can provide insights into which specific records are causing the conflict.
Test Migration:
- Perform a test migration with a smaller dataset to identify and resolve issues before executing the full migration.
